Transaction 33ca01bdd5ae4b22a4a709b008958d090ffaf5cdf543b79153d752ef34aff8c5

3 Input
1 Outputs
  • 33ca01bdd5ae4b22a4a709b008958d090ffaf5cdf543b79153d752ef34aff8c5:0
  • value  9315209
    address  3BrBf8sLSsszbKNDZBNvCP6VMxHevEWzTL